Oracle 10g客戶端的安裝配置操作詳解
Oracle 10g客戶端的安裝配置對我們使用Oracle的用戶來說是相當重要的,合理地安裝配置好Oracle客戶端會給我們的工作帶來很大的方便。本文我們主要介紹一下Oracle 10g客戶端的安裝配置工作,接下來我們就開始一一介紹。
一、配置Oracle服務(wù)器的監(jiān)聽器listener
修改<安裝目錄>/network/admin/目錄下的listener.ora和tnsnames.ora兩個文件。其中
listener文件大致如下:
- # listener.ora Network Configuration File: /oracle/app/product/10.1.0/db_1/network/admin/listener.ora
- # Generated by Oracle configuration tools.
- SID_LIST_LISTENER =
- (SID_LIST =
- (SID_DESC =
- (SID_NAME = PLSExtProc)
- (ORACLE_HOME = /oracle/app/product/10.1.0/db_1)
- (PROGRAM = extproc)
- )
- (SID_DESC =
- (GLOBAL_DBNAME = demo1) #demo1為oracle實例名
- (ORACLE_HOME = /oracle/app/product/10.1.0/db_1)
- (SID_NAME = demo1)
- )
- )
- LISTENER =
- (DESCRIPTION_LIST =
- (DESCRIPTION =
- (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1))
- (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.0.100)(PORT = 1521)) #IP地址為oracle服務(wù)器
- )
- )
tnsnames.ora文件大致修改如下:
- # tnsnames.ora Network Configuration File: /oracle/app/product/10.1.0/db_1/network/admin/tnsnames.ora
- # Generated by Oracle configuration tools.
- DEMO1 =
- (DESCRIPTION =
- (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.0.100)(PORT = 1521)) #IP地址為oracle服務(wù)器
- (CONNECT_DATA =
- (SERVER = DEDICATED)
- (SERVICE_NAME = DEMO1) #demo1為oracle實例名,或者服務(wù)名稱此名稱可通過netmgr或netca修改
- )
- )
- EXTPROC_CONNECTION_DATA =
- (DESCRIPTION =
- (ADDRESS_LIST =
- (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1))
- )
- (CONNECT_DATA =
- (SID = PLSExtProc)
- (PRESENTATION = RO)
- )
- )
以上修改也可通過圖形界面的netmgr和netca進行配置。修改之后,重啟監(jiān)聽器。
二、下載安裝oracle客戶端。
在安裝pl/sql developer的本地機器上必須安裝oracle客戶端(此處指針對oracle 10g版本,有說也可只安裝相關(guān)驅(qū)動如oci驅(qū)動,
具體不詳。并且客戶端不一定為10g版本,8i,9i皆可)。
1.從官網(wǎng)上下載綠色版本的客戶端,地址如下(或有改變):
http://www.oracle.com/technology/software/tech/oci/instantclient/index.html
下載需要oracle用戶,可免費注冊。
2.綠色版無需安裝,將此下載解壓至某處,并在其下建立一network目錄,目錄下再建admin目錄,結(jié)構(gòu)如下
<客戶端目錄>/network/admin,在admin目錄中建立tnsnames.ora文件,內(nèi)容大致如下:
- demo1 = #oracle服務(wù)名
- (DESCRIPTION =
- (ADDRESS_LIST =
- (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.0.100)(PORT = 1521)) #oracle服務(wù)器地址與端口
- )
- (CONNECT_DATA =
- (SERVICE_NAME = demo1)
- )
- )
三、在PL/SQL developer中配置客戶端信息。
打開PL/SQL developer,暫不登錄,選擇菜單tools->preferences->connection,設(shè)置如下兩項:
Oracle Home: D:\Program Files\instantclient_11_1 #客戶端解壓目錄。
OCI library: D:\Program Files\instantclient_11_1\oci.dll #oci庫文件路徑,oci.dll應(yīng)該在客戶端目錄下。
保存,重啟PL/SQL developer,些時應(yīng)可看到登錄框中Database下拉選項里有你剛剛配置的遠程服務(wù)器上的服務(wù)實例demo1了。
關(guān)于Oracle 10g客戶端的安裝配置的知識就介紹到這里了,如果您想了解更多關(guān)于Oracle數(shù)據(jù)庫的知識,可以看一下這里的文章:http://database.51cto.com/oracle/,相信一定可以帶給您收獲的!
【編輯推薦】






